Manny has a client who wants to purchase a commercial building. Manny doesnt have much experience negotiating commercial purchases. Which action should Manny take to demonstrate good faith and ethical behavior toward his client?
Correct Answer: D
Rationale: Transparency fosters trust in client relationships. By informing the client of his inexperience while expressing a commitment to consult with a professional broker, Manny demonstrates ethical behavior and good faith. This approach allows the client to make informed decisions and reassures them that their interests are prioritized.
Option A lacks transparency, potentially misleading the client and undermining trust. Option B involves secrecy, which is unethical and could jeopardize the client's position if issues arise. Option C, while honest, unnecessarily abandons the client instead of seeking support, which does not align with a commitment to their best interests.
